United States v. Bostick, No. 04-3074 Consolidated with 05-3010, 05-3011, 05-3012, 05-3013,
UNITED STATES COURT OF APPEALS FOR THE DISTRICT OF COLUMBIA CIRCUIT, March 29, 2007, Filed
View this case - free
|
Overview: In criminal appeal, defense counsel was authorized under 21 U.S.C.S. § 848(q)(10) to obtain law clerk and paralegal services, with such services partially paid in interim payments if supported by detailed and itemized time and expense statements. Balance was payable upon submission of a final voucher detailing expenses and time for the entire case.
